Cabo Verde holds Spain to 0-0 draw at World Cup
Summary

Cabo Verde and Spain played to a 0-0 draw on June 15, 2026, in Atlanta at the FIFA World Cup. The match, marked by strong defensive play from Cabo Verde, showcased the team's organized strategy against the Euro 2024 champions. Despite Spain's attempts to score, their efforts fell short, leading to a notable result for the underdogs. The match is part of a tournament that has seen surprising outcomes, with underperforming teams challenging established favorites.
